A clever, funny picture book about one of life’s most important skills: the art of saying sorry.
Sammy is in trouble. He’s stuck in his room (on his mum’s birthday!) writing sorry letters for things he shouldn’t have done. But what exactly has Sammy done?
Told entirely through Sammy’s letters, this inventive and laugh-out-loud story gradually reveals the chaos behind his well-meaning plan. As one apology letter leads to another, the story of Sammy’s robot-related adventure unfolds . . .
But the big question is will Sammy make it out of his room in time to celebrate his mum’s birthday? And what’s going on with all the robots?
A fresh take on one of life’s essential lessons, Sorry, Sammy combines laugh-out-loud humour with a heartfelt message about making things right.
Scott Rothman is a screenwriter and the author of Attack of the Underwear Dragon, Return of the Underwear Dragon and Blue Bison Needs a Haircut. Scott is also the author of recently published picture books Parfait, Not Parfait and Mako and Tiger: Two Not-So-Friendly Sharks. Scott lives in the Connecticut suburbs with his wife and three children.
Tom Tinn-Disbury is an experienced illustrator who started his career in film and animation before concentrating on his art. He has written and illustrated a number of picture books, including The Caveman Next Door and Stuck in the Middle. Tom uses a mix of pens, pencils, paint and Photoshop to create his art, and coffee and sandwiches to write his stories! He lives in Rugby, Warwickshire.
